+public class AppsFailureReceiver extends BroadcastReceiver {
+
+ private static final int FAILURES_THRESHOLD = 3;
+ private static final int EXPIRATION_TIME_IN_MILLISECONDS = 30000; // 30 seconds
+
+ private int mFailuresCount = 0;
+ private long mStartTime = 0;
+
+ // This function implements the following logic.
+ // If after a theme was applied the number of application launch failures
+ // at any moment was equal to FAILURES_THRESHOLD
+ // in less than EXPIRATION_TIME_IN_MILLISECONDS
+ // the default theme is applied unconditionally.
+ @Override
+ public void onReceive(Context context, Intent intent) {
+ String action = intent.getAction();
+ final long currentTime = SystemClock.uptimeMillis();
+ if (ACTION_APP_FAILURE.equals(action)) {
+ if (currentTime - mStartTime > EXPIRATION_TIME_IN_MILLISECONDS) {
+ // reset both the count and the timer
+ mStartTime = currentTime;
+ mFailuresCount = 0;
+ }
+ if (mFailuresCount <= FAILURES_THRESHOLD) {
+ mFailuresCount++;
+ if (mFailuresCount == FAILURES_THRESHOLD) {
+ // let the theme manager take care of getting us back on the default theme
+ IThemeService tm = IThemeService.Stub.asInterface(ServiceManager
+ .getService(CMContextConstants.CM_THEME_SERVICE));
+ final String themePkgName = ThemeConfig.SYSTEM_DEFAULT;
+ ThemeChangeRequest.Builder builder = new ThemeChangeRequest.Builder();
+ builder.setOverlay(themePkgName)
+ .setStatusBar(themePkgName)
+ .setNavBar(themePkgName)
+ .setIcons(themePkgName)
+ .setFont(themePkgName)
+ .setBootanimation(themePkgName)
+ .setWallpaper(themePkgName)
+ .setLockWallpaper(themePkgName)
+ .setAlarm(themePkgName)
+ .setNotification(themePkgName)
+ .setRingtone(themePkgName)
+ .setRequestType(RequestType.THEME_RESET);
+ // Since we are resetting everything to the system theme, we can have the
+ // theme service remove all per app themes without setting them explicitly :)
+ try {
+ tm.requestThemeChange(builder.build(), true);
+ postThemeResetNotification(context);
+ } catch (RemoteException e) {
+ /* ignore */
+ }
+ }
+ }
+ } else if (ThemeUtils.ACTION_THEME_CHANGED.equals(action)) {
+ // reset both the count and the timer
+ mStartTime = currentTime;
+ mFailuresCount = 0;
+ }
+ }

+public class IconCacheManagerService extends Service {
+ private static final String TAG = IconCacheManagerService.class.getSimpleName();
+
+ private static final long MAX_ICON_CACHE_SIZE = 33554432L; // 32MB
+ private static final long PURGED_ICON_CACHE_SIZE = 25165824L; // 24 MB
+
+ private long mIconCacheSize = 0L;
+
+ private void purgeIconCache() {
+ Log.d(TAG, "Purging icon cahe of size " + mIconCacheSize);
+ File cacheDir = new File(ThemeUtils.SYSTEM_THEME_ICON_CACHE_DIR);
+ File[] files = cacheDir.listFiles();
+ Arrays.sort(files, mOldestFilesFirstComparator);
+ for (File f : files) {
+ if (!f.isDirectory()) {
+ final long size = f.length();
+ if(f.delete()) mIconCacheSize -= size;
+ }
+ if (mIconCacheSize <= PURGED_ICON_CACHE_SIZE) break;
+ }
+ }
+
+ private Comparator<File> mOldestFilesFirstComparator = new Comparator<File>() {
+ @Override
+ public int compare(File lhs, File rhs) {
+ return (int) (lhs.lastModified() - rhs.lastModified());
+ }
+ };
